Anastasiia is a Ukrainian feminine given name derived from the Greek Anastasia, itself from anastasis, meaning resurrection. It shares its roots with the widely used Anastasia and the Russian form Anastasiya, all ultimately tracing back to the same Greek theological concept central to Christian belief. The name was borne by several early Christian martyrs, most notably Saint Anastasia of Sirmium, which helped spread it throughout the Orthodox and Catholic worlds. Anastasia, Anastasiya, and Stasya are among the closely related forms found across Slavic and other European traditions.
